Wood Siding Painting in Longmont, CO

Wood siding painting services involve preparing and applying fresh paint or stain to the exterior wooden surfaces of a property. This service is commonly requested for homes and buildings that feature wood siding, including clapboard, shingles, or board-and-batten styles. Projects may include surface cleaning, sanding, priming, and applying multiple coats of paint or stain to enhance the appearance, protect the wood from weather damage, and extend its lifespan. Property owners typically seek this service to update the look of their home, improve curb appeal, or maintain the integrity of the wood siding.

Before requesting wood siding painting services, property owners often want to understand the condition of their existing siding, including whether it requires repairs or extensive prep work. It’s also helpful to consider the type of paint or stain best suited for their specific siding material and climate conditions. Clarifying the scope of work, such as whether stripping old paint or addressing underlying issues is included, can ensure expectations are aligned. Proper preparation and finishing are essential for a long-lasting, attractive result that protects the home’s exterior.

FAQ

Wood Siding Painting Questions

What types of wood siding can be painted? Most common wood siding types, including cedar, pine, and redwood, can be painted to enhance durability and appearance.

Why is painting wood siding beneficial? Painting provides protection against weather elements and helps maintain the siding’s aesthetic appeal over time.

How often should wood siding be repainted? Repainting is typically recommended every 5 to 10 years, depending on exposure and condition of the siding.

What preparation is needed before painting wood siding? Proper cleaning, scraping loose paint, and priming are essential steps to ensure a smooth and lasting finish.
